程序员如何实现财富自由系列之:利用程序员技能成为自由职业者

164 阅读8分钟

1.背景介绍

随着科技的发展,自由职业者的数量不断增加,尤其是程序员。自由职业者可以根据自己的技能和兴趣来选择工作,而不是被公司的政策和环境束缚。在这篇文章中,我们将探讨如何利用程序员的技能来实现财富自由。

1.1 自由职业者的优势

自由职业者有以下优势:

  1. 更高的工资:自由职业者可以根据自己的技能和经验来设定工资,而不是受公司的工资制度限制。
  2. 更多的自由:自由职业者可以根据自己的兴趣和需要来选择工作,而不是被公司的政策和环境束缚。
  3. 更好的成长空间:自由职业者可以不断地学习和提升自己的技能,而不是受公司的培训制度限制。

1.2 自由职业者的挑战

自由职业者也面临以下挑战:

  1. 税收:自由职业者需要自己处理税收,而不是受公司的税收制度保护。
  2. 保险:自由职业者需要自己购买保险,而不是受公司的保险制度保护。
  3. 社会保险:自由职业者需要自己购买社会保险,而不是受公司的社会保险制度保护。

1.3 如何成为自由职业者

要成为自由职业者,程序员需要以下步骤:

  1. 掌握技能:程序员需要掌握一些技能,例如编程、数据分析、机器学习等。
  2. 建立个人品牌:程序员需要建立自己的个人品牌,例如创建个人网站、发布个人作品等。
  3. 寻找客户:程序员需要寻找客户,例如通过社交媒体、网络论坛等方式来寻找客户。
  4. 提供服务:程序员需要提供服务,例如编程、数据分析、机器学习等服务。
  5. 收取费用:程序员需要收取费用,例如通过支付宝、支付宝等方式来收取费用。

1.4 如何保持财富自由

要保持财富自由,自由职业者需要以下步骤:

  1. 保持技能更新:自由职业者需要保持技能更新,例如学习新的技术、提高自己的技能等。
  2. 保持客户关系:自由职业者需要保持客户关系,例如定期与客户沟通、提供优质服务等。
  3. 保持税收合规:自由职业者需要保持税收合规,例如按时缴纳税收、合规的税收处理等。
  4. 保持保险合规:自由职业者需要保持保险合规,例如购买合适的保险、合规的保险处理等。
  5. 保持社会保险合规:自由职业者需要保持社会保险合规,例如购买合适的社会保险、合规的社会保险处理等。

2.核心概念与联系

在这一部分,我们将介绍核心概念和联系。

2.1 核心概念

  1. 自由职业者:自由职业者是指那些不受公司制约的工作者,他们可以根据自己的技能和兴趣来选择工作。
  2. 技能:技能是指那些可以帮助人们完成某项任务的能力。
  3. 个人品牌:个人品牌是指那些可以帮助人们建立自己形象的品牌。
  4. 客户:客户是指那些可以帮助人们获得收入的人。
  5. 服务:服务是指那些可以帮助人们提供价值的工作。
  6. 收入:收入是指那些可以帮助人们获得财富的钱。

2.2 核心联系

  1. 技能与自由职业者:技能是自由职业者的基础,只有掌握了技能,自由职业者才能提供价值的服务。
  2. 个人品牌与自由职业者:个人品牌是自由职业者的形象,只有建立了个人品牌,自由职业者才能吸引客户。
  3. 客户与自由职业者:客户是自由职业者的收入来源,只有获得了客户,自由职业者才能获得收入。
  4. 服务与自由职业者:服务是自由职业者的工作,只有提供了服务,自由职业者才能获得收入。
  5. 收入与自由职业者:收入是自由职业者的财富,只有获得了收入,自由职业者才能实现财富自由。

3.核心算法原理和具体操作步骤以及数学模型公式详细讲解

在这一部分,我们将介绍核心算法原理和具体操作步骤以及数学模型公式详细讲解。

3.1 核心算法原理

  1. 技能掌握:通过学习和实践,自由职业者可以掌握一些技能,例如编程、数据分析、机器学习等。
  2. 个人品牌建立:通过创建个人网站、发布个人作品等方式,自由职业者可以建立自己的个人品牌。
  3. 客户寻找:通过社交媒体、网络论坛等方式,自由职业者可以寻找客户。
  4. 服务提供:通过编程、数据分析、机器学习等服务,自由职业者可以提供价值的服务。
  5. 收入收取:通过支付宝、支付宝等方式,自由职业者可以收取费用。

3.2 具体操作步骤

  1. 选择技能:根据自己的兴趣和需要,自由职业者可以选择一些技能,例如编程、数据分析、机器学习等。
  2. 学习技能:通过学习和实践,自由职业者可以掌握一些技能,例如编程、数据分析、机器学习等。
  3. 建立个人品牌:通过创建个人网站、发布个人作品等方式,自由职业者可以建立自己的个人品牌。
  4. 寻找客户:通过社交媒体、网络论坛等方式,自由职业者可以寻找客户。
  5. 提供服务:通过编程、数据分析、机器学习等服务,自由职业者可以提供价值的服务。
  6. 收取费用:通过支付宝、支付宝等方式,自由职业者可以收取费用。

3.3 数学模型公式详细讲解

  1. 技能掌握:通过学习和实践,自由职业者可以掌握一些技能,例如编程、数据分析、机器学习等。
  2. 个人品牌建立:通过创建个人网站、发布个人作品等方式,自由职业者可以建立自己的个人品牌。
  3. 客户寻找:通过社交媒体、网络论坛等方式,自由职业者可以寻找客户。
  4. 服务提供:通过编程、数据分析、机器学习等服务,自由职业者可以提供价值的服务。
  5. 收入收取:通过支付宝、支付宝等方式,自由职业者可以收取费用。

4.具体代码实例和详细解释说明

在这一部分,我们将介绍具体代码实例和详细解释说明。

4.1 技能掌握

# 编程技能
def programming(skill):
    return skill

# 数据分析技能
def data_analysis(skill):
    return skill

# 机器学习技能
def machine_learning(skill):
    return skill

4.2 个人品牌建立

# 创建个人网站
def create_website():
    return "个人网站"

# 发布个人作品
def publish_work():
    return "个人作品"

4.3 客户寻找

# 通过社交媒体寻找客户
def find_customer_on_social_media():
    return "客户"

# 通过网络论坛寻找客户
def find_customer_on_forum():
    return "客户"

4.4 服务提供

# 提供编程服务
def provide_programming_service(customer):
    return "编程服务"

# 提供数据分析服务
def provide_data_analysis_service(customer):
    return "数据分析服务"

# 提供机器学习服务
def provide_machine_learning_service(customer):
    return "机器学习服务"

4.5 收入收取

# 收取编程费用
def collect_programming_fee(customer):
    return "收取编程费用"

# 收取数据分析费用
def collect_data_analysis_fee(customer):
    return "收取数据分析费用"

# 收取机器学习费用
def collect_machine_learning_fee(customer):
    return "收取机器学习费用"

5.未来发展趋势与挑战

在这一部分,我们将介绍未来发展趋势与挑战。

5.1 未来发展趋势

  1. 技术发展:随着技术的发展,自由职业者将能够提供更多的技术服务。
  2. 市场需求:随着市场需求的增加,自由职业者将能够获得更多的客户。
  3. 社会变革:随着社会变革,自由职业者将能够适应更多的社会环境。

5.2 挑战

  1. 竞争:随着竞争的增加,自由职业者将面临更多的竞争。
  2. 保持技能:随着技术的发展,自由职业者需要保持技能的更新。
  3. 保持客户:随着市场需求的变化,自由职业者需要保持客户的关系。

6.附录常见问题与解答

在这一部分,我们将介绍常见问题与解答。

6.1 常见问题

  1. 如何掌握技能?
  2. 如何建立个人品牌?
  3. 如何寻找客户?
  4. 如何提供服务?
  5. 如何收取费用?

6.2 解答

  1. 掌握技能:通过学习和实践,可以掌握一些技能,例如编程、数据分析、机器学习等。
  2. 建立个人品牌:通过创建个人网站、发布个人作品等方式,可以建立自己的个人品牌。
  3. 寻找客户:通过社交媒体、网络论坛等方式,可以寻找客户。
  4. 提供服务:通过编程、数据分析、机器学习等服务,可以提供价值的服务。
  5. 收取费用:通过支付宝、支付宝等方式,可以收取费用。